what is that metal clicking and popping sound whenever i change gears?

what is that metal clicking and popping sound whenever i change gears?

P to R, click.
P to D, pop.
R to D or D to R, huge jolt and clunk.
brake to full stop, click.

Had a 2011 Z4 35i and now a 2016 Z4 35is. Both with DCT. There is a "clunk" when moving in/out of "P". I believe this is the transmission lock like regular auto tranny. Noise is louder when taking in/out of parking on an incline. I noticed it is similar when changing from drive to reverse. It's not as loud as I interpret your initial description. A recording of the sound would be better to help assess.

I had a 2008 VW GTI with DSC (their dual clutch). I did experience loud noise as you described. They had a recall on the DSC on a bushing that wears out prematurely. Once they replaced the bushing, I no longer had the loud noise.
